> What about guests that use the capslock LED for something useful, instead of
> capslock?
>
For VNC, tracking modifier state is already a heuristic so this series
just adjusts that heuristic in a way that is better for 99% of use-cases.
I agree that we have to be careful about how we use information like
this particularly when it comes to issues of correctness, but I don't
believe this is such an instance.
